OK, let’s start from the beginning.
Can you explain to me why Charles didn’t have any brake problems in the first three races? Australia, China and Japan? (49–41pts in Charles’s favour)
Round 4: Miami Grand Prix: Ferrari brought its first major upgrade package, including updated rear suspension and braking system.
The updates introduced in Miami have changed the way the team uses the braking system (including for tyre temperature management). As a result, Leclerc has lost the ‘feel’ he had at the start of the season.
Loic Serra, who was responsible, amongst other things, for these modifications, had previously worked with Lewis at Mercedes and had previous experience with Carbone Industrie brakes. This was one of the reasons behind the introduction of these changes, from which, notably, Hamilton benefited.
From the Spanish Grand Prix onwards, Charles started using CI pads and disc; the rest are still from Brembo.
Now that Charles feels comfortable with the CI brakes, it’s clear from the results: the last four races (76–58pts in Charles’s favour)
